On 01/20/2012 02:54 PM, Milan Bouchet-Valat wrote:
> Hi!
>
> With kernels 3.2 and 3.2.1, my Broadcom 4313 wireless card doesn't work
> after suspend: I need to reload the brcmsmac module by hand on resume.
> It worked fine with 3.1 kernels.
>
> So I tried compat-wireless-next today (on Fedora 16), and it still
> doesn't work, though instead of oopses I get warnings. ;-)
>
> The error messages are:
> [ 165.612939] ieee80211 phy0: wl0: wlc_coreinit: ucode did not self-suspend!
> [ 165.751978] ieee80211 phy0: wl0: wlc_suspend_mac_and_wait: waited 83000 uS
> and MI_MACSSPNDD is still not on.
> [ 165.751989] ieee80211 phy0: wl0: psmdebug 0x00ff8181, phydebug 0x00000031,
> psm_brc 0x0000
>
> (the two latter repeated many times, see attached dmesg.log)
>
> Please ask for any details you may need (output of lspci -vnn is
> attached too, just in case).
>
>
> PS: Please keep me in CC, as I'm not subscribed to the list
I am not sure when compat-wireless-next was generated, but several
patches were made for suspend/resume. You also need bcma patches. Is
bcma included in the compat-wireless package.
